首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 软件管理 > 软件开发 >

【设计形式】19.适配器模式

2012-08-29 
【设计模式】19.适配器模式适配器模式:将一个类的接口变换成客户端所期待的另一种接口,从而使原本因接口不匹

【设计模式】19.适配器模式
适配器模式:将一个类的接口变换成客户端所期待的另一种接口,从而使原本因接口不匹配而无法在一起工作的两个类能够在一起工作。
优点:
1.适配器模式可以让两个没有任何关系的类在一起运行,只要适配器这个角色能够搞定他们就成。
2.增加了类的透明性。
3.提高了类的复用度。
4.灵活性非常好。

package com.syc.designpatterns.chapter19;public class Client {public static void main(String[] args){//IUserInfo youngGirl = new UserInfo();IUserInfo youngGirl = new OuterUserInfo(); // 替换上面调用,体现适配器模式for(int i=0;i<101;i++){youngGirl.getMobileNumber();}}}

热点排行